During school year 2010-2011(the most recent data year available), Lamar Junior High School Middle School had 801 students and 58 full time teachers. The student ratio was 13.8. Regarding the gender, 382 students were female, 418 students were male. Regarding the racial makeup of the students, 142 were white, 207 were African American, 396 were Hispanic, 45 were Asian(including Hawaiian Native/Pacific Islander), 5 were American Indian or Alaska Native, 5 were reported from two or more races.
Totally 516 students were eligible for subsidized lunch program: 464 students were eligible for free lunch, 52 students were eligible for reduced price lunch.Lamar Junior High School Middle School is located at 4814 Mustang Ave, Rosenberg, TX 77471. The school environment is Suburb, Large Territory.
Lamar Junior High School Middle School belongs to Fort Bend County and is managed by Lamar Cisd school district. It serves students from grade 07 to grade 08.
